At the heart of technological progress in towing is the use of sophisticated GPS tracking systems. Gone are the days when dispatch personnel relied solely on verbal directions and physical maps. Today, GPS technology enables real-time tracking of both tow trucks and customers’ locations, ensuring prompt service and enhanced route efficiency. Moreover, advances in communication technology have reshaped how towing companies interact with their customers. With the widespread use of mobile applications, clients can easily request towing services with a few clicks on their smartphones. These apps often feature integrated communication platforms that allow for seamless dialogue between dispatchers, drivers, and vehicle owners. The result is a more transparent service with real-time updates that keep customers informed every step of the way.
Telematics is another technological innovation that plays a vital role in modern towing services. By using onboard diagnostic systems, towing operators can continuously monitor the health and performance of their vehicles. This data not only helps to prevent breakdowns by forecasting maintenance needs but also enhances overall fleet management. Advancements in automotive technology itself have also impacted towing services. Vehicles today are built with complex electronics and require specialized equipment and knowledge to tow safely. Tech-driven training programs are now essential in educating towing professionals on how to handle these new vehicles without causing additional damage. Environmental concerns have also influenced technological innovations in the towing industry. Hybrid and electric tow trucks are becoming increasingly popular as companies strive to reduce their carbon footprint. These vehicles not only contribute to a cleaner environment but often require less maintenance and result in cost savings that can be passed on to consumers.
